Two or Three Witnesses
A brother once shared that the wisdom God gives us in how to handle disputes is very similar to how He deals with us in our trespasses against Him. When there are things in our lives that God does not like, He comes to us directly to put light on those things through personal conviction by His Holy Spirit. If we do not take heed, He will send two or three witnesses to confirm the word of the Spirit. If even then we do not turn, He will expose the issue before the church. If our heart is hardened still, we become like the heathen.

Consider how each of these steps illustrates the character of God. He continually works to turn us from sin. God is longsuffering, and there is a whole lot of 'stepping over' we must do to go around His commands. He gets no pleasure in damning people to hell, but desires that men repent and live (Ezekiel 18:23-32, 33:11; Luke 15:20-24; II Peter 2:9). Therefore, He gives us plenty of space to do so.
